A happy workforce is essential for any successful company. When employees are happy and content in their jobs, they are more likely to be motivated, productive, and engaged in their work. This positive attitude has a ripple effect throughout the entire organization, leading to increased morale, higher job satisfaction, and ultimately, a more successful business.
One of the key benefits of a happy workforce is increased productivity. When employees are happy at work, they are more likely to be motivated to do their best, resulting in higher levels of productivity. Happy employees are also more engaged in their work, leading to increased efficiency and better overall performance. This is because when employees are happy, they are more likely to go the extra mile, putting in the effort needed to achieve their goals and help the company succeed.
happy workforces also tend to have higher levels of morale. When employees are happy and satisfied in their jobs, they are more likely to have a positive outlook on their work and the company as a whole. This positive attitude can help to create a more supportive and collaborative work environment, where employees feel valued and appreciated. When employees feel supported and respected, they are more likely to work well together, fostering a sense of teamwork and camaraderie among colleagues.
Job satisfaction is another key benefit of a happy workforce. When employees are happy in their jobs, they are more likely to feel fulfilled and satisfied with their work. This can lead to higher levels of job satisfaction, which in turn can lead to lower turnover rates and increased employee retention. Happy employees are less likely to leave their jobs, resulting in a more stable and consistent workforce. This can save companies time and money on recruiting and training new employees, as well as helping to maintain a positive company culture.
Creating a happy workforce involves more than just providing competitive salaries and benefits. Companies must also focus on creating a positive work environment that fosters happiness and satisfaction among employees. This can involve providing opportunities for growth and development, recognizing and rewarding employees for their hard work, and encouraging open communication and feedback. Companies that prioritize employee well-being and happiness are more likely to have happy and engaged workforces.
One way to boost morale and happiness among employees is to provide opportunities for socialization and team building. This can involve organizing team outings, company events, or social gatherings where employees can get to know each other outside of work. Building strong relationships and a sense of community among employees can help to create a more positive and supportive work environment, where employees feel connected and valued.
Another way to create a happy workforce is to provide opportunities for growth and development. Employees who feel that they are learning and growing in their jobs are more likely to be satisfied and engaged in their work. Companies can offer training programs, mentorship opportunities, and other resources to help employees develop their skills and advance their careers. Investing in employee growth and development can lead to increased job satisfaction and loyalty among employees.
Recognizing and rewarding employees for their hard work is also crucial for creating a happy workforce. Employee recognition programs can help to motivate and inspire employees, while also reinforcing positive behaviors and attitudes. Companies can recognize employees for achievements, milestones, or simply for doing a great job. This can help to boost morale and job satisfaction, while also fostering a culture of appreciation and gratitude within the organization.
